Quicky AI vs Poke (Interaction Co.)
Side-by-side comparison of features, pricing, and ratings
At a glance
| Dimension | Quicky AI | Poke (Interaction Co.) |
|---|---|---|
| Pricing | One-time fee (bring your own API key) | Free tier; Pro $19/mo; Ultra $199/mo |
| Platform | Browser extension (desktop) | Apple Messages, WhatsApp, Telegram, RCS (mobile + desktop) |
| Core Function | Chat, summarize, reword, explain any webpage via ChatGPT | Manage email, calendar, reminders, tasks, integrations via messaging |
| Key Integrations | OpenAI API (GPT-4o, etc.) | Gmail, Outlook, Notion, Oura, TripIt, Todoist |
| Target User | Power users comfortable with API key management | Individuals wanting a proactive AI assistant across messaging apps |
| Latest News | No recent updates | Poke now verified on Apple Messages; supports Telegram; TripIt automation; @poke.com email |
Choose Quicky AI if you need a one-time-pay browser tool to summarize, reword, or explain any webpage using your own OpenAI key — ideal for researchers and writers. Choose Poke if you want an AI assistant inside your messaging apps that manages email, calendar, and connected services (Notion, Oura, etc.) with proactive automations — best for those who prefer chat-based productivity. Poke's freemium model and rich integrations give it broader appeal, but Quicky AI is a better fit for budget-conscious page-focused users.

Do I need an OpenAI API key for Quicky AI?
Yes, Quicky AI requires you to bring your own OpenAI API key and pay OpenAI directly for usage.
Can Poke work without a smartphone?
Poke works inside Apple Messages, WhatsApp, Telegram, and RCS — these require a smartphone or desktop app, but the assistant is chat-based.
Which tool supports GPT-4o?
Both Quicky AI (via your API key) and Poke Pro (frontier models) support GPT-4o or similar, but Poke's Pro tier includes access.
Is Poke free to use?
Poke has a free tier with limited features. Pro ($19/mo) and Ultra ($199/mo) unlock more capabilities and automations.
Can I use Quicky AI offline?
No, Quicky AI requires internet to call the OpenAI API and fetch webpage content.
Does Poke integrate with Notion?
Yes, Poke connects to Notion for pages, databases, and documents.
Which is better for email management?
Poke directly integrates with Gmail and Outlook for reading, drafting, and sending emails via chat.
Do both tools support custom prompts?
Quicky AI has custom prompt templates; Poke uses Recipes for automations, which are more workflow-oriented.
